The IG report confirmed that Brennan lied to Congress when he said the debunked Steele dossier was not relied upon for the Obama administration’s Intelligence Community Assessment (ICA).
The ICA was used to inform still-President Obama and then-President-elect Trump in January 2017 about Russian attempts to interfere in the 2016 election.
According to The Federalist, “FBI Deputy Director Andrew McCabe said that ‘he felt strongly that the Steele election reporting belonged in the body of the ICA, because he feared that placing it in an appendix was ‘tacking it on’ in a way that would ‘minimiz[e]’ the information and prevent it from being properly considered.”
In fact, “the ICA included a short summary and assessment of the dossier, which was incorporated in an appendix. ‘In the appendix, the intelligence agencies explained that there was ‘only limited corroboration of the source’s reporting’ and that Steele’s election reports were not used ‘to reach analytic conclusions of the CIA/FBI/NSA assessment,’ the IG report states.”
However, months later, in May 2017, Brennan was insistent in his testimony before the House Permanent Select Committee on Intelligence that the CIA did not rely on the Steele dossier for the ICA report. His exchange with fromer Rep. Trey Gowdy includes the lie …
Mr. Gowdy: Do you know if the Bureau ever relied on the Steele dossier as any — as part of any court filings, applications, petitions, pleadings?
Mr. Brennan: I have no awareness.
Mr. Gowdy: Did the CIA rely on it?
Mr. Brennan: No.
Mr. Gowdy: Why not?
Mr. Brennan: Because we — we didn’t. It wasn’t part of the corpus of intelligence information that we had. It was not in any way used as a basis for the Intelligence Community assessment that was done. It was — it was not.
The IG report clearly contradicts that testimony. The Federalist article points out: “On page 179 of the IG report, IG investigators asked former FBI Director James Comey if he remembered discussions with Brennan on presenting the dossier to Obama. Comey said Brennan and other officials argued it was ‘important’ enough to include in the ICA — clearly part of the ‘corpus of intelligence information’ they had.”
All in all, the IG report on FISA abuse found a total of 51 violations and 9 false statements, according to the report’s appendix.
